Letter from Theodore Roosevelt to Curtis Guild
Subject(s): African American soldiers, Military discipline, Race relations, United States. Army
Click on image to zoom in
President Roosevelt says the order to investigate will not be changed under any circumstances even though the soldiers guilty of misconduct are African American and not white. He says those trying to appeal to him are ignorant of the charges against the soldiers. Roosevelt feels indifferent about any political attacks the soldiers may be trying to make against him. He asserts that the race of the soldiers does not impact his decision to investigate the matter at all.
